Instructions
Place the wine, water, sugar, honey, lemon zest, ginger, and cinnamon stick in a large pot.
Split the vanilla bean, remove the seeds, and add both the seeds and the pod to the pot.
Stir the mixture and place it over medium heat, until it comes to a low simmer.
When it has reached a simmer, turn the heat down to low, peel the pears, and add them to the pot.
Place a circle of parchment or a plate directly on top of the pears, to weigh them down and prevent browning.
Simmer the pears in the liquid until they are very soft (approx. 20 minutes).
Remove the poached pears from the pot, turn the heat up to high, and boil the liquid until it's reduced to a syrup.
Serve the poached pears warm, at room temperature, or chilled, with a drizzle of the syrup.
